Dressing up, token efforts, Olly Murs and party season...
This week we've discovered women can be divided into four types when it comes to fancy dress:
  • There are those who love to dress up and view fancy dress as a chance to leave the house near naked(!) If you like being gloriously under-dressed and dolled up then at least get some gorgeous undies!

  • There are those who choose to make it a comedy effort (like our editor who ordered a giant pumpkin outfit like the X Factor's Olly Murs - we love him). If this is your bag then you probably go the whole hog with themed food and drink too.

  • There are women who make a token effort and if this is you we recommend a good look through our gothic accessories story even the girls in the next category found something to love in our stylebook!

  • Finally there are women who hate fancy dress and take a bah humbug attitude to the whole thing. There are one or two of these at soFeminine HQ and they're having more fun choosing new hats, scarves and gloves for autumn - not a spider or a skull in sight!
We're a mixed bag here at soFeminine - from those who go all out to those just go as themselves. Whatever our preference of attire we all agree on one thing. Halloween means it's time to get the party started! Roll on November, roll on Christmas...
